Hotmail won't open, delete or move emails!

Hello,

Firstly, apologies if this is the wrong place but I couldn't find an appropriate forum.

I have a brand new computer and it won't let me open my e-mails on Hotmail. I can log-in, see the list of emails but absolutely nothing happens when I click on an email to read it, try to move it, delete it etc.

I have tried using IE8 and Mozilla Firefox and the same thing happens. Sometimes absolutely nothing happens, whereas othertimes it will says javascript in the bottom left corner (I thought I didn't have the correct java so I downloaded the latest version). Other times it tells me Done, but with errors on page.

Webpage error details

User Agent: Mozilla/4.0 (compatible; MSIE 8.0; Windows NT 6.1; WOW64; Trident/4.0; SLCC2; .NET CLR 2.0.50727; .NET CLR 3.5.30729; .NET CLR 3.0.30729; Media Center PC 6.0; MANM; MANM)
Timestamp: Thu, 12 Aug 2010 10:40:57 UTC


Message: '__classes' is undefined
Line: 292
Char: 1134
Code: 0

I can open my emails on my laptop, just not on my new desktop so I'm thinking Ihave an incorrect setting or something? I actually have no idea and it's driving me bonkers. Plus, I can use the internet fine for any other web pages, and can open my yahoo mail.

Please help me!!!
Thanks

By any chance do you connect to the internet using a Tmobile dongle?
I had a problem on a laptop I was looking at that was similar. I can find the post I started if you do use a tmobile dongle. If not theres a few things you can do like try firefox, or delete all your temporary files and restore IE to factory settings. Google those terms and there will be a whole load of info.
